  • COM Surrogate has stopped working suddenly?

    I had my PC Windows 7 Home Premium 64 - bit since March, 2012.

    Tonight, October 17, 2014, I started getting an error "COM Surrogate has stopped working" pop up, all the time, for no apparent reason.

    I can not play with Windows Media Player AVI files without this message and ALSO a message that WMP has ALSO stopped working.

    I can't play AVI files in right click on the video and using 'Play with WMP Basic' without also getting this message as soon as I do a right click.

    I don't know if it's related, but since YESTERDAY I can't load YAHOO! in Internet Explorer. The page will simply not load, so I can't check my email official, formal and work-related.

    Chrome works very well, so I CAN access YAHOO! my general, leisure, pleasure and e-mails related to the game.

    I always allow upgrades of Windows, so I don't understand why it started to happen out of the blue.

    I have a current Antivirus with BitDefender Total Security and perform regular maintenance.

    Any suggestions on a fix for this?

    Thank you very much

    (Moved to programs)

    The first error points to the ffdshow.ax:

    Fault Module name: ffdshow.AX
    Fault Module version: 1.3.0.0
    Module Timestamp error: 53aedcb1

    The second error points to the avformat-lav - 55.dll:

    Fault Module name: avformat-lav - 55.dll
    Fault Module version: 55.43.100.0
    Module Timestamp error: 00029000

    The ffdshow.ax and avformat-lav - 55.dll can be components of a pack of codecs such as the K-Lite Codec Pack.

    Codec packs are / are installed?

    You can uninstall the codec packs and see if the error resolves?

  • Remote Desktop has stopped working suddenly Premium Ultimate

    I used to be able to remote desktop to my laptop with Vista Home Premium on my desktop with Vista Ultimate. All of a sudden, it stopped working (March 09). I tried many steps of troubleshooting without success and I searched and searched online with no resolution. Help! I examined even the laptop to ultimate upgrade, but I seriously doubt that would correct the problem, since I should be able to remote desktop ON the ultimate machine (not in it, of course) and did so successfully for over a year... so far. I don't know what changed between yesterday and today, with the exception of Windows updates. No other software or hardware has been installed. The laptop has wireless and it works very well - I can access the Internet and the network with no problems at all.

    Steps, I have taken/other info: (not necessarily in order - just write them as they come to me)
    1) reset all the workstations and the router (I have a 3rd computer which has XP also).
    (2) checked to make sure port 3389 is open on my router 2 and in the firewall (McAfee). Within McAfee, do ensure that the remote desktop program and service were allowed, both directions and on all the workstations. Also controlled canyouseeme.org to ensure that port 3389 is indeed open and he succeeded.
    (3) connection I tried with the firewall disabled on two workstations and always without success.
    (4) Made sure that on the host, the remote settings have been enabled and all users can connect, using any version of Windows. Also tried unchecking, reset and rechecked.
    (5) the user accounts on all workstations are directors.
    (6) the fact that the Terminal Server service has been started on the host. Tried them stopping and restarting.
    (7) tried ping - success in all directions by the two IP address and computer name.
    (8) network resources are available in all directions - I can see and access files shared all around.
    (9) installed all the Windows updates available. Reloaded later.
    (10) remote desktop from the laptop to the machine off XP is successful. Ultimate machine to XP is successful. From XP to ultimate is successful. The only one who does not work (and it's an important) is from the laptop to the machine by excellence. Argh!
    (11) even tried to restore the laptop provided the factory (tested - didn't work) and then through all Windows updates (test I went - never able to operate).
    (12) fact that Windows Firewall has been disabled on all workstations.
    (13) fact that network discovery, file sharing and public folder sharing is turned on.
    (14) RDP I tried with the name of the computer with the IP address.
    What Miss me? The only thing I can think is that somehow one of Windows Update caused this problem, but my research online for someone else knows this at the same time me are coming short. So I'm completely confused and frustrated!
    Thanks for reading my post, and I'd appreciate any help.
    Sally

    I didn't need to post on the technet forum, because I have solved the problem. I decided to bite the bullet and just give my idea to try and hope for the best (created a first system restore point). The solution was so freakin ' easy... wonder why I couldn't find all the details on how to do...?

    In any case; On the ultimate box (the one I am trying to remote desktop in), I opened the management console (mmc.exe) and add the Certificates snap, for the computer account, computer local. Double click on certificates, double click on the desktop folder remotely, double click on the Certificates folder and highlighted the certificate (there was only one, with the name of the computer as the title) and removed (first of all, I copied and put it in another folder, just in case where).

    This solves completely the whole issue and workaround is no longer necessary.

  • ENVY DV7 sound has stopped working! If I reset it comes back for a little bit.

    Computer is a year old. Windows 8. If I reset the computer the sound lights as long as im using, but the second I walk and return its judgment and does not work. Help!

    Hello

    Check if the following makes a difference.

    Do a right-click the speaker icon in the taskbar, and select playback devices.  Right click 'Speakers and headphones' (or speakers/HP), and then select Properties.  Select the Advanced tab, and then remove the check box "allow applications to take exclusive control of this device."  Click apply and then click Ok to save this change.

    Restart the laptop.
